The aside tag, as the name states, separates a portion of the content from the main content of the page. This tag is used to represent a component of a page that consists of a self-contained composition in a document or a page of the site. The area tag is used to define the area of a clickable section when using area mapping. The applet tag is not supported in HTML 5 the same functionality can be arrived at using the Object tag. This tag is used to insert a Java code that works within HTML. The address tag defines the contact information of the owner or author of the page on which it is defined. This tag is similar to the abbreviation tag, but is used when the acronym is a spoken word, such as GUI, NASA, etc. This tag, usually called the abbreviation or acronym tag, is used to show the full form of an abbreviation or acronym on a mouse-over, with its title attribute. The link of the interconnected page needs to be inserted as part of the href attribute, which makes the text accessible, and directs you to the said page on clicking the linked text. The anchor tag, as this tag is called, interconnects two pages (unidirectional) with the help of a page address. The document type tag does not have an end tag. It is to help the browser understand the version and type of web page, without which the browser would not be able to even recognize the webpage. This is the document type tag, which is actually not a tag, but a declaration of the version of HTML that is used. It is mostly used by coders to insert comments in various sections of the page for their reference, and make such comments not visible to end users, and in the browser. PDFKit provides fine-grained control over the content, layout, and formatting of PDF documents.This tag, also known as the comments tag, is used to hide comments and text from showing up on the final page.Since it is open source and actively maintained by the community, PDFkit is continuously improved and updated.You can customize the HTML content if you‘d like’. This will run the script, generate a PDF file named example.pdf with the specified content, and save it to your project directory. We end the document using doc.end(), and then handle the finish event of the stream to log a success message when the PDF is generated. We add HTML content to the PDF using the text method to specify font size and alignment. Next, we pipe the PDF output to a writable stream or file named example.pdf. In this script, we import the fs (file system) module and the PDFDocument class from the PDFKit library, and then create a new PDF document using PDFDocument. Here’s an example: const puppeteer = require('puppeteer') Ĭonst browser = await puppeteer.launch() Īwait tContent('Hello, Puppeteer!') Īwait page.pdf() Now, write the conversion script inside your JavaScript file. It will download the necessary Chromium browser binaries automatically: Next, install the Puppeteer library as a dependency in your project. To do so, run npm init-y in your Node.js project. To set up and use Puppeteer, you’ll first need to initialize your Node.js project. Setting up and using Puppeteer for HTML to PDF conversion It leverages the capabilities of the Chrome or Chromium web browser to render HTML content into PDF files. Puppeteer allows you to automate various tasks in a web browser, such as web scraping, website testing, screenshot creation, and PDF generation. It is the most popular open-source HTML-to-PDF converter, supporting HTML, CSS, and JavaScript. Puppeteer is a Node.js library developed by Google that provides a high-level API for controlling headless (or full) Chrome or Chromium browsers. Feature comparison: Puppeteer, jsPDF, and PDFKit.Setting up and using PDFKit for HTML to PDF conversion.Setting up and using jsPDF for HTML to PDF conversion.Setting up and using Puppeteer for HTML to PDF conversion.In this article, we’ll investigate and compare three popular HTML to PDF libraries for Node.js applications: Puppeteer, jsPDF, and PDFKit. It’s also useful for sharing dynamic web pages, and bulk data from web applications. HTML to PDF conversion is helpful for web apps that return documents like receipts, invoices, reports, or bank statements. There are many scenarios where it’s useful to export HTML content and then download it as a PDF, or Portable Document Format, document for easy sharing. It provides a structure for web content by using various elements and tags to define the different parts of a web page, such as headings, paragraphs, links, images, forms, and more. HTML, or HyperText Markup Language, is the standard markup language used to create web pages and is an essential technology for building websites.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|